Erdem Spring 2011



I was swept off my feet when I saw Erdem's Spring 2011 collection...literally. I begged my mom on hands and knees to give me her floral embroidered dresses she used to wear when she was my age now but yeah...my luck most of them get lost somehow and the few she still has are really really really short and simply tight...well I come after my 2 metre tall dad.
All that aside the collection is utterly ravishing. There's not a single piece that I don't like. Especially the white dresses with layers and layers of lace  are a vision.
Typically for Erdem is of course his faible for floral embroidery and yet another time he's excelled himself.
Why I love this collection? I love flowers, embroidery and every colour the paint-box has and now you just have to look at these (shirt-)dresses,skirts and shoes' delicacy and detail. Do you feel the prickling in your stomach and the excitement the vivid colours cause? I do....and I can't wait for spring to come where I wanna dress in bright paradise colours.


One of my most  favourite ones is the white  lace dress whichs is over-embroidered with red floral motifs (2nd row, 3rd from left). It reminded me of the Turkish flag and that those two colours even if they appear simple can be  this mesmerizing.
